Displaying Modeless Forms
Contrary to a modal form, a modeless form allows the user to shift the focus
between the form and another form without closing the initial form. Modeless
forms are useful when you want the user to refer to one form from another, such
as with tool windows and Help windows. However, modeless forms can be a
handful because the user can access them in an unpredictable order.This compli-
cates your task as the developer to keep the state of your application consistent.
